Data Science Intern – Summer & Fall 2026
CME Group is seeking a proactive and skilled Data Science Intern for the 2026 Summer and Fall 2026 terms. This role supports the Manager of Data Science in client development analytics, focusing on transforming various data sources into actionable business insights that drive sales initiatives.
Key Responsibilities (Principal Accountabilities):
Execute data acquisition, ETL (Extract, Transform, Load) processes utilizing tools such as SQL (Big Query) and SAP Business Object.
Develop compelling data visualizations using Tableau, Looker, Streamlit, or R Shiny.
Perform data processing and develop analytical models.
Required Skills and Qualifications:
Skills / Software Requirements:
Strong proficiency in a scripting language (e.g., Python, R). Proficiency in SQL and Microsoft Excel.
Proficiency with Tableau.
Experience with cloud service platforms (e.g., GCP, AWS, Azure)
Education:
Must be currently pursuing a bachelor’s or master’s degree in a quantitative discipline (e.g., Math, Statistics, Data Science, Financial Engineering, Engineering).
A finance background is highly advantageous.
Internship Details:
Timing: May 2026 – December 2026
Hours:
Summer: 32 hours per week
Fall: 16 hours per week
This is an in-person only position

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ene
Key Facts About Charlotte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
-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
-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
-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
-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
